The ongoing conflict in Ukraine has led to numerous war crimes attributed to Russian forces. In Pokrovsk, Russian invaders have been reported to shoot seven civilians, raising significant human rights concerns. Ukrainian police discuss with the U.S. to hold Russia accountable for these crimes. Russian FPV drones have also been implicated in war crimes during civilian evacuations. The prosecutor's office is actively investigating several incidents, including the execution of Ukrainian soldiers in Donetsk region and the use of civilians as "human shields". Over 190,000 war crimes by Russian troops have been recorded, and an historic transfer of a Russian soldier to Lithuania for war crimes trial marks a significant step in international justice efforts.

SBU identifies Russian marine who executed nine Ukrainian POWs Confession of captured ruscist who executed nine Ukrainian POWs in Kursk region. VIDEO The Security Service of Ukraine (SBU) has collected irrefutable evidence and obtained a confession from a serviceman of the Russian Armed Forces who committed a brutal execution of Ukrainian defenders. As Censor.NET reports, the war criminal was identified as Serhii Skobeliev, a fighter of the notorious 155th Separate Marine Brigade of Russia’s Pacific Fleet. 12 798 78 Previously in trend: War crimes of Russia

Russian surgeons from the so-called "Friends of Donbas Medicine" group Media identified Russian surgeons who had burned "Glory to Russia" on body of Ukrainian prisoner. PHOTO The inscription "Glory to Russia" and the letter Z on the body of Ukrainian prisoner of war Andrii Pereverzev were made during an operation at the largest hospital in Donbas – the "Donetsk Clinical Territorial Medical Association" (DOKTMO). This inscription could have been left by Russian surgeons from the so-called "Friends of Donbas Medicine" group. 28 685 51 Previously in trend: War crimes of Russia

Russian soldier handed over to Lithuania to be punished for war crimes Ukraine has handed over Russian soldier to Lithuania for first time to stand trial for war crimes, - Kravchenko. VIDEO For the first time since the start of the full-scale war, Ukraine has handed over a Russian serviceman to a foreign state, Lithuania, for actual criminal prosecution for war crimes. This is a historic precedent and an important step for the international justice system. 3 524 8 Previously in trend: Investigation of Russian war crimes

abduction of Ukrainian children Russian Ombudsman Lvova-Belova publicly admitted that she had kidnapped and "re-educated" Ukrainian child from Mariupol. VIDEO Russian Presidential Commissioner for Children's Rights Maria Lvova-Belova, who is wanted by a court in The Hague for illegal deportation of children, gave an interview in which she described how she had actually kidnapped and adopted a Ukrainian child from Mariupol after the city had been captured by the Russian army. 8 978 39 Previously in trend: Abduction of children by Russia
